Artifact Signing — Skylark Deep-Link Router. All routing-table artifacts for the Skylark mobile router are signed before distribution; devices verify the signature prior to applying any deep-link mapping update. Security reviewers should confirm that only the Harbinger CI host performs signing and that the verification step cannot be bypassed via the debug flag. For audit purposes, the signing material currently in use is recorded below.

rollout seal: bky4_yke3

Key ceremony item 7 — search relevance notes. Confirm the Lanternfish tuning notes (synonym weights, recency boost, the Harwick field-length fix) are exported and sealed with the ceremony artifacts. Release manager signs the manifest; two witnesses initial. Notes must match build 4.2 exactly — no post-freeze edits. Sealed copy goes in the offline locker alongside the signing material. The locker's recovery passphrase is recorded on the line below.

unlock words, yagep-fahof: belix-rusvan-casdor-gorox-aldath-norael-istix-quenael-fraeth-silael

Provenance records from the Marrowgate build farm showed timestamps drifting up to 40 seconds between agents, because agent pool C synced against a stale stratum server. Attestations are now ordered by monotonic sequence numbers rather than wall clock, and skew above 5 seconds fails the run. The trace token for the corrected pipeline run follows below.

pipeline stamp: htk21_86b657ac0aa916a9af17f

## Wellness Room Access — Visiting Contractors

Welcome to Dunmore Place! Contractors can use Wellness Room 1A on the ground floor — handy for a breather between site checks. Book a slot on the lobby tablet (max one hour) and tidy up after yourself; next person will thank you. The room sits behind the secure corridor, so your visitor lanyard alone won't open it. When your booking starts, punch in the door code below at the keypad.

door code, kawip-bagap: bdg-HQEWH-4

- [ ] **Step 7: Breaker override escrow.** After sealing the signing keys for the Tallgrove upstream API circuit breaker, confirm the support team can force the breaker open during a full outage. The override bundle lives in the sealed escrow drawer and is useless without its unlock phrase. Two ceremony witnesses must initial this step before proceeding. The escrow bundle is decrypted with the recovery passphrase that follows.

vault phrase of kahip-kahop = holath-quenmir